BOYS IN BROWN HANDED SAARLAND TRIP IN DFB CUP ROUND 1

FC St. Pauli will travel to the winners of the Saarland state cup competition in the first round of the DFB Cup (11-14 September). The draw was made in Cologne on Sunday evening. 

As not all of the state cup competitions have been completed, 23 of the 64 first-round participants have yet to be determined. In FC Diefflen, FC Saarbrücken, Halberg Berbach, SV Elversberg, FC Homburg, TuS Herrensohr, SV Auersmacher, and Borussia Neunkirchen, that means the Boys in Brown have eight possible opponents. The final of the Saarland Cup will take place on 22 August.

Head coach Timo Schultz: "The chance of us not knowing much more about our first-round opponents than we did before was relatively high. Nevertheless, we're looking forward to the competition, which always has a special allure. The aim is clear – to go further than we have done in recent years. We'll now wait and see who wins through in Saarland. A tie against Saarbrücken would certainly be attractive after their great cup run last season, but I don't have any favourites – we'll take it as it comes."
